Output ddf1443878b9ebce207514ccfae684fa45b1bed0c5dbe388c626d2691710635d:16

value
23322259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2efc37b4ac1ad7d332c685f3797b433b9da9d73e OP_EQUAL
address
MCBbTe6tncPNAs58nkughPKg3RsuFP71jy
transaction
ddf1443878b9ebce207514ccfae684fa45b1bed0c5dbe388c626d2691710635d
spent
true